# Break-Glass Access — GridLoom Crossword Generator

GridLoom builds the daily crossword grids. If the generator wedges and normal deploy credentials fail, use break-glass access. Rules: page the on-call first, open an incident, and note your name in the access log. Break-glass grants fifteen minutes of admin on the GridLoom scheduler — enough to restart the fill engine and flush stuck puzzles. Access is audited; misuse is revoked permanently. To unseal the break-glass credential store, enter the recovery passphrase below.

vault phrase of bagaf-kajeg = jorath-feniel-briir-siliel-ralix

## Authentication

The old homegrown queue (Crankshaft) had no auth. Its replacement, Beltline, requires a key on every enqueue and dequeue call. Pass it in the request header; Beltline rejects anything unsigned with a 401. Keys are scoped per worker pool — do not reuse the ingest pool's key for reporting jobs. Rotation happens quarterly via the platform console. The current staging key for local testing is below.

app token of tagef-tafog = qvz3-7n0

Welcome aboard. You'll be working on the Brimvale consent banner rollout. Banner config lives in the `consent-shell` repo; regions go live in waves, gated by the `cb-wave` flag. Don't flip flags without sign-off from the rollout lead. Wave schedule, flag names, and QA steps are listed on the internal page.

dashboard of bafof-hafog = https://confluence.lumiclabs.internal/display/browse/display/6a09a20a

Handover Note — Reseller Programme

From the outgoing to the incoming director of channel sales at Vantrell Instruments. The reseller programme covers eleven partners; the Stonemere and Aldquist accounts need renewal attention this quarter. Margin tiers were revised in spring and are holding. Heads of department should read the strategic note appended directly below.

confidential, bagep-bagag: The renewal with Druathax Group closes at $10 million a year, 10 percent below the last contract. Project Zorael slips by a full year because of the staffing delay.